REFILE-Italy seizes assets of Putin ally and judo partner Rotenberg

ROME, Sept 23 (Reuters) - Italian authorities seized property worth about 30 million euros ($40 million) belonging to companies controlled by a close associate of Russian President Vladimir Putin, targeted by EU and U.S. sanctions, a finance police official said on Tuesday.
